About Illgen Falls
Illgen Falls is a picturesque waterfall located along the Baptism River in Tettegouche State Park, Minnesota. It features a dramatic drop into a rocky gorge, making it a popular spot for photography and nature enthusiasts.
The Setting
Illgen Falls sits at 932 feet within Tettegouche State Park, in the foothills of Minnesota. The falls drop 40 feet.

Trail Description
The trail to Illgen Falls is a short and easy walk from the parking area near the Illgen Falls Cabin. The path is well-maintained and leads directly to a viewing area overlooking the falls. Visitors should exercise caution near the edge of the gorge.

When to Visit
The best time to visit Illgen Falls is during spring or after heavy rainfall when the water flow is at its peak. Fall is also a great time to visit due to the vibrant autumn foliage.

Safety Information
Exercise caution near the edge of the gorge as the rocks can be slippery. Stay on designated trails and avoid venturing too close to the water. Be aware of changing weather conditions.

Getting There
Illgen Falls is located within Tettegouche State Park, approximately 60 miles northeast of Duluth, Minnesota. The falls can be accessed via Highway 1 and Highway 61. Follow signs to the park entrance and parking areas.

Nearby Attractions
Other attractions within Tettegouche State Park include High Falls, Two Step Falls, and Shovel Point. The park also offers hiking trails, rock climbing, and scenic views of Lake Superior.
